一尘不染

#1062-键“ PRIMARY”的重复条目

mysql

所以我的MySQL数据库表现得有些奇怪。这是我的桌子:

Name shares id  price   indvprc
cat   2     4   81      0
goog  4     4   20      20
fb    4     9   20      20

当我尝试插入表时出现此#1062错误。因此,我进一步研究了它,并意识到当我尝试在名称和共享值相同的表中插入值时,它将返回#1062错误。例如,如果我插入:

fb    4      6     20   20

它将返回错误。但是,如果我将共享数更改为6,它将运行正常。是因为我的专栏之一可能是唯一的,还是仅与mysql有关?


阅读 452

收藏
2020-05-17

共1个答案

一尘不染

您需要删除shares作为PRIMARY KEYORUNIQUE_KEY

2020-05-17